Handover note — Splitlane assignment service

Taking over from Marek this sprint. Splitlane assigns users to A/B experiment arms; assignments are sticky per account, not per session. The pending release bumps the hashing salt rotation — do not ship it while experiment 47 is live, or arms will reshuffle. Everything else is routine. For the release checklist, the current production configuration is as follows.

config for yajep-tafof:
[rusath]
team = julmir
access_code = ac_fe37fd
host = rusath.novactech.test
port = 8000
owner = pelmir.weneth
peer = oliwyn.olvarqdyn.internal

## Releases

Crashline ships a new pipeline build every Monday. Support staff can verify which build processed a given crash report by checking the `pipeline_tag` field. Builds are produced by the Fenwick CI cluster and must be signed before the ingest nodes accept them. For verification, use the release signing key below.

rollout seal: bky4_x7Gc

# Webhook retry semantics for Driftgate
# Failed deliveries are retried with exponential backoff: 5s, 30s, 2m,
# then hourly up to 24 attempts. After exhaustion, payloads move to the
# dead-letter table and are never auto-replayed. Retry state is tracked
# in the delivery database rather than in memory, so reviewers should
# audit that store directly. It is reachable via the connection string below.

replica DSN, kajep-yahag: mssql://praok_svc:iF@db-8d68.plorvaio.local:5432/eliion

Hey — handing over the Murwood Museum audio-guide app before I'm out next week. The big thing in flight is the 3.2 release: offline audio bundles are done, but the beacon-pairing fix is still in review and flaky on older handsets. Don't cut the release until Petra signs off on that one. Release notes are drafted, changelog is half-done, sorry. Everything else is green. I've written up the full release checklist and open items on the internal page below.

dashboard of fajop-badug = https://jira.qorvelsys.internal/pages/pages/pages/display